COMUNIDADES DE ENERGÍA COMO ESTRATEGIA DE DESARROLLO SOSTENIBLE
ESTUDIO DE CASO PARA CONDOMINIOS EN CEARÁ
Resumen
The global concern for the social, environmental and economic sustainability of the planet has sparked the need to develop intelligent systems and new forms of organization to overcome the challenges of a carbon-free energy transition; one of the possibilities is the organization of prosumers into Energy Communities (EC). Hence, the goal of this paper is to analyze EC as a strategy for a sustainable development; as case study is considered ALPHAVILLE CEARÁ - RESIDENCIAL 1 AND 2 condominium, made up of 1,002 residential plots. The study starts with the standardization of a Family Unit (UF) with an average monthly consumption of 1,158 kWh; using the PVSYST program, a 9.31 kWp photovoltaic (PV) plant is dimensioned using the UF's generation data; in a second stage, extrapolation is carried out for different levels of adherence to the EC (25%, 50% and 100%). The results obtained for the levels of participation in the EC confirm the potential relevance obtained by increasing the number of participants, providing positive financial results and contributing to the sustainable growth of the Condominium.
